//! Binary content detection via null-byte heuristic.

use crate::constants::BINARY_DETECT_SIZE;

/// Detect whether data is binary by checking for null bytes in the first 8 KiB.
///
/// # Examples
///
/// ```
/// use atomwrite::binary_detect::is_binary;
///
/// assert!(is_binary(&[0x00, 0x01, 0x02]));
/// assert!(!is_binary(b"hello world"));
/// assert!(!is_binary(b""));
/// ```
pub fn is_binary(data: &[u8]) -> bool {
    let check = &data[..data.len().min(BINARY_DETECT_SIZE)];
    check.contains(&0)
}
